The import of reeds, healds, and heald-frames for weaving looms to China is showing a downward trend from 2024 to 2028, with each year experiencing a slight reduction in volume. The year-on-year percentage change indicates a consistent decrease, suggesting a steady decline in demand or potential advancements in domestic manufacturing capabilities. Notably, the absence of 2023 data limits context for immediate year comparison.
Future trends to watch for:
- Technological advancements in domestic production that could reduce reliance on imports.
- Changes in global supply chains impacting import volumes.
- Evolving textile industry demands in China that might alter import needs.
